Abstract

2451. Lenthall, C. B. Feb. 1. Calculating-apparatus. -Relates to means for calculating the height of the tide for any time at a place for which the height of the mean spring tide and the time of high water are known. A pivoted arm moves over a scale divided in one form into six hours and the quarters, or, as shown, into four, five, six, seven, or eight hours and quarters, and a scale A is fitted sliding parallel to the diameter of the circular scale and graduated to show height of tide. Setting is effected by bringing the half mean spring height of tide opposite the centre of rotation of the arm, and bringing a slider on the arm to the high-water for the day, the arm being coincident with the diameter. On moving the arm round through the interval that has elapsed since high-water, the reading on the scale A opposite the slider on the arm gives the required height. A simple slider may be employed as described above or, as shown, a pin on a nut L carried by a screwed arm N and adjusted by bevel gear from a milled head P may have a pin engaging a light sliding slotted plate J carrying the pointer H. The scale may be operated by means of a pinion. Instead of mechanical parts, suitable circles and lines may be employed as shown in Fig. 5.
